数据可视化后台的API接口有哪些?

在当今数字化时代,数据可视化已经成为企业、政府和研究机构展示数据信息的重要手段。而数据可视化后台的API接口,则是实现这一功能的关键。本文将详细介绍数据可视化后台的API接口,帮助读者了解其功能和应用。

一、数据可视化后台API接口概述

数据可视化后台的API接口,是指通过编程语言调用的接口,用于实现数据可视化功能。它可以将数据源与可视化工具进行连接,实现对数据的实时展示和分析。以下是几种常见的数据可视化后台API接口:

  1. D3.js API接口

D3.js是一个基于Web标准的数据驱动文档(Data-Driven Documents)的JavaScript库,它提供了丰富的API接口,可以实现各种数据可视化效果。D3.js API接口主要包括:

  • SVG API接口:用于创建和操作SVG元素,实现图形的绘制和交互。
  • DOM API接口:用于操作HTML和CSS,实现数据的渲染和交互。
  • Data API接口:用于处理和操作数据,实现数据的转换和展示。

  1. ECharts API接口

ECharts是由百度团队开发的一个开源可视化库,支持多种图表类型。ECharts API接口主要包括:

  • 系列API接口:用于定义图表的系列,如折线图、柱状图、饼图等。
  • 坐标轴API接口:用于定义图表的坐标轴,如数值轴、时间轴等。
  • 提示框API接口:用于显示图表的提示信息,如数据标签、工具提示等。

  1. Highcharts API接口

Highcharts是一个功能强大的JavaScript图表库,支持多种图表类型。Highcharts API接口主要包括:

  • 图表API接口:用于创建和配置图表,如折线图、柱状图、饼图等。
  • 轴API接口:用于定义图表的轴,如数值轴、时间轴等。
  • 系列API接口:用于定义图表的系列,如折线图、柱状图、饼图等。

二、数据可视化后台API接口的应用

数据可视化后台的API接口在各个领域都有广泛的应用,以下是一些典型案例:

  1. 金融行业

在金融行业,数据可视化后台的API接口可以用于展示股票、期货、外汇等金融数据的实时走势。例如,通过D3.js API接口,可以创建一个动态的折线图,实时展示某只股票的股价走势。


  1. 医疗行业

在医疗行业,数据可视化后台的API接口可以用于展示疾病统计数据、患者病情分析等。例如,通过ECharts API接口,可以创建一个饼图,展示某地区不同疾病的发病率。


  1. 教育行业

在教育行业,数据可视化后台的API接口可以用于展示学生的学习成绩、学习进度等。例如,通过Highcharts API接口,可以创建一个柱状图,展示某班级学生的成绩分布。

三、总结

数据可视化后台的API接口是实现数据可视化功能的关键。本文介绍了D3.js、ECharts和Highcharts等常见的数据可视化后台API接口,并分析了其在各个领域的应用。希望本文对读者了解和掌握数据可视化后台的API接口有所帮助。

猜你喜欢:服务调用链